The Path to Success: Progress in Your Profession and Resume Building
Are you looking to advance in your career and boost your professional profile? Progressing in your profession and building a compelling resume are key steps to achieving your goals. Whether you are aiming for a promotion, exploring new opportunities, or enhancing your skills, focusing on career advancement can significantly impact your success.
1. Set Clear Goals
Define your career objectives and set clear, achievable goals. Whether you aim to lead a team, specialize in a particular area, or pursue a higher position, having a clear direction will guide your professional development.
2. Continuous Learning
Stay updated with the latest trends and technologies in your field. Pursue certifications, attend workshops, and engage in continuous learning to enhance your skills and knowledge. This will not only keep you competitive but also demonstrate your commitment to growth.
3. Networking
Build a strong professional network by connecting with industry peers, attending conferences, and engaging in networking events. Networking can open up new opportunities, provide valuable insights, and help you establish meaningful connections in your field.
4. Showcase Achievements
Highlight your accomplishments and contributions in your resume. Quantify your achievements, showcase projects you have led, and demonstrate the impact of your work. A well-crafted resume that emphasizes your successes can make you stand out to potential employers.
5. Develop Soft Skills
In addition to technical skills, focus on developing soft skills such as communication, teamwork, and leadership. Employers value candidates who possess strong interpersonal abilities, as these skills are essential for success in any role.
6. Seek Feedback
Solicit feedback from mentors, colleagues, or supervisors to gain insights into areas for improvement. Constructive feedback can help you identify blind spots, refine your skills, and grow professionally.
7. Stay Updated
Keep yourself informed about industry trends, job market demands, and professional opportunities. Being aware of market developments can help you adapt to changes, identify growth areas, and make informed decisions about your career.
Conclusion
By setting clear goals, continuously learning, networking, showcasing achievements, developing soft skills, seeking feedback, and staying updated, you can progress in your profession and build a strong resume.
